#f58482 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f58482 is composed of 96.1% red, 51.8%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.1%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 1 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 73.5%. #f58482 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eb0905.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#f58482 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f58482 has RGB values of R:245, G:132,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.47,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16090242.

Shades and Tints of #f58482
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#feefef is the lightest one.

Tones of #f58482
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cbbbb is the less saturated color, while #fa7f7d is the most saturated one.
